- next_monitor_id -> AtomicU64 on RuntimeInner - timers -> own Mutex<Timers>; io -> own Mutex<Option<IoThread>> (lock order: io-before-shared) - pending_closures Vec folded into Slot::pending_closure - termination check reads io liveness before shared; ordering argument documented - poison fix: check_cancelled() no longer fires while preemption is disabled, so a cancellation unwind can never poison a runtime/channel mutex - regression test: tests/poison_stop.rs - ROADMAP_v0.5.md added

//! Regression: request_stop racing an alloc-under-lock must not poison any
|
|
//! runtime mutex. Before the fix, check_cancelled() fired regardless of
|
|
//! PREEMPTION_ENABLED, so a sentinel unwind could trigger inside with_shared
|
|
//! (which allocates: run_queue.push_back, waiters.push, etc), poisoning the
|
|
//! shared mutex and cascading lock().unwrap() panics.
|
|
|
|
use smarm::runtime::{init, Config};
|
|
use std::sync::atomic::{AtomicUsize, Ordering};
|
|
use std::sync::Arc;
|
|
|
|
#[test]
|
|
fn stop_storm_does_not_poison_runtime() {
|
|
let rt = init(Config::exact(4));
|
|
let completed = Arc::new(AtomicUsize::new(0));
|
|
let c = completed.clone();
|
|
rt.run(move || {
|
|
// Spawn many short actors that allocate + yield heavily (hammering
|
|
// with_shared), and request_stop each one mid-flight from siblings.
|
|
let mut handles = Vec::new();
|
|
for _ in 0..200 {
|
|
let h = smarm::spawn(|| {
|
|
for _ in 0..50 {
|
|
let _v: Vec<u8> = Vec::with_capacity(64); // alloc → maybe_preempt
|
|
smarm::yield_now();
|
|
}
|
|
});
|
|
handles.push(h);
|
|
}
|
|
// Cancel half of them; the others run to completion. If any lock got
|
|
// poisoned the runtime would panic on a subsequent lock().unwrap().
|
|
for (i, h) in handles.iter().enumerate() {
|
|
if i % 2 == 0 {
|
|
smarm::request_stop(h.pid());
|
|
}
|
|
}
|
|
for h in handles {
|
|
let _ = h.join();
|
|
}
|
|
c.fetch_add(1, Ordering::SeqCst);
|
|
});
|
|
assert_eq!(completed.load(Ordering::SeqCst), 1, "root completed cleanly");
|
|
}
